
What is recorded here
In improved pasture, lying prostrate (long axis NE-SW) adjacent to WNW of cairn (TS060-072001-). Sub-rectangular piece of cut sandstone conglomerate (L 1.04m; Wth 0.2-0.28m; T 0.2-0.22m) with narrow projection at one end. Worn punch-dressed effect on surface may be natural. Large irregular sandstone to SW. Site of holy well (TS060-072003-) adjacent to NW. According to OS Namebooks (O'Donovan 1840), this is the 'site of a well, [and] a small cairn with a cross upon it'.
